Table of Contents

Preface 1: Ethology, physiological psychology, and neurobiology of CTA 2: The CTA paradigm: Terminology, methods, and conventions 3: Neuroanatomy of CTA: Lesions studies 4: Functional ablation studies of CTA 5: Pharmacology of CTA 6: Electrophysiology of CTA 7: Funtional morphology of CTA 8: Transplantation studies 9: Paradoxes, projections, and perspectives of CTA research References Index

Reviews

Here's a book that triggers various recollections--depending upon our past experiences with food, picnics, family outings, desserts, and parties!! Interestingly subtitled 'Memory of a Special Kind', the short volume . . . goes heavily into neuroanatomy, physiology, and molecular biochemistry. Perhaps of most interest to toxicologists is the 15-page chapter on the pharmacology of conditioned taste aversion. This section deals with drugs offering emetic effects, the potential for toxicity as a role in the development of taste aversion, the role of peptides and their interaction with other stimuli, and reviews of neuropharmacology studies dealing with flavor.
